Betty's Obituary

Betty Lou (Brooks) Huddleston,95, went home to be with her savior on Wednesday, October 15, 2025 at Brooke Knoll Village in Avon, IN.Betty was born in Indianapolis, IN on August 24, 1930 to Goldie (Ewing) and Charlie Brooks. She graduated from Ben Davis HS in 1948.She served as a Sunday School...
